    I broke my foot... Now I have a low grade fever

    Hello everyone, yesterday morning I ended up fracturing my foot. I was in immediate pain and the area is very swollen. When I went to urgent care, I was told I had a temp of 100.1. I was surprised, because I didn't even feel sick. I've taken my temp several times since, and it's been higher than my norm.

    Does anyone have any insight on this? My thought is that maybe the fever is in response to the inflammation? But part of me thinks maybe it's due to an underlying disorder like cancer: ( I'm trying not to Google! I have no chills or fatigue or sore throat or anything.

    What did urgent care say? Did they seem concerned?

    I would bet that it is due to inflammation, but I would keep an eye out for infection. High fever, or if the area is really red or hot to the touch. I'd continue to monitor your temperature just to be sure, but if urgent care wasn't concerned about the fever it's likely just fine and to be expected. Do you have a regular doc you could follow up with?
